The Indian Army’s dedication to modernizing its artillery force, improving border security, and attaining greater self-reliance in defense technology is demonstrated by the continuous growth of its Pinaka rocket regiments. With its quick firepower, long range, and accuracy, the Pinaka system is expected to form the mainstay of India’s long-range artillery capabilities for many years to come.
